This document provides a checklist for commissioning a HVAC system. It outlines steps to check field copper piping, coil fins, oil traps, filter driers, expansion valves, and control wiring. It also lists items to check in electrical work including motor terminals, disconnect switches, power to heaters, and control panels. Control items are checked like valves, dampers, differential pressure switches, and temperature controls. Startup tests include measuring motor winding resistance, checking cabling and terminations, testing safety interlocks, and verifying proper motor rotation. An inspector signs off on the commissioning.
